Is A Monza street-legal?

6 The Ferrari Monza Is Street Legal In Europe But Not In The United States. When a brand decides to chop off the roof and windows from its car, it naturally becomes a cause of safety concern. And owing to this, the Monza SP1 has been deemed illegal to drive on U.S. streets.

Are speedsters road legal?

Both of them use a 6.5-litre V12 making 809 bhp, and the prodigious output is enough for the pair to reach 62 miles per hour in 2.9 seconds and 124 mph in 7.9 seconds. The top speed is above 186 mph. Despite the spartan bodywork and interior features, the pair of models is road legal.

Why is Monza so fast?

The speed

Because of the unique characteristics of the Monza circuit, Formula 1 teams bring downforce packages that are developed especially for the race weekend. Minimal downforce is needed to optimise the long straights, with 83% of the lap being on full throttle.

Why is Monza so popular?

It's The Most Held Grand Prix In History

Along with the British Grand Prix, it is the only race to be held every year since the sport's inception in 1950, and apart from 1980 when the race moved to Imola, Monza has held every race.

Can Ferrari take your car if you mod it?

8 Modifying The Cars Too Much

Ferrari has a clause in their contracts that state that the owners may not modify their new Ferraris before a certain amount of time has passed. This doesn't mean new owners are not allowed to touch it at all, but modifications such as wide-body kits are a big no-no.

Is it legal to drive a F1 car on the street?

Formula 1 cars are not street legal. The main reason F1 cars cannot be driven on the street is that several of their systems and design elements do not adhere to the restrictions of the Department of Transportation or other regulatory agencies.

Why is Red Bull slow in Monza?

Red Bull technical director Pierre Wache revealed that the comparatively slow speeds was down to a deliberately higher downforce rear wing configuration. When asked by Autosport for an explanation, he said: “I think it is not due to the engine, for sure. It is clearly due to the level of drag we run on the car.

What's the fastest F1 track?

Monza - Grand Prix Circuit

An iconic 220mph+ start/finish straight, the thrilling Curva Grande, the tricky two Lesmos and the Parabolica which slingshots cars back into doing it all again makes for the fastest lap in F1, with an average lap of 164mph.

Can you take alcohol into Monza F1?

Food & Drink at Monza

If you are on a budget, visit a shop before you head to the circuit to stock up on food and drink, but remember you cannot bring any glass, cans or alcohol. Being Italy, the food and drink on offer at Monza is better than at other circuits, but still overpriced.
